智慧校园信息化建设领导者

整合践行智慧校园信息化建设解决方案

首页 > 资讯 > 排课系统> 基于云计算的上海走班排课系统技术实现与优化

基于云计算的上海走班排课系统技术实现与优化

排课系统在线试用
排课系统
在线试用
排课系统解决方案
排课系统
解决方案下载
排课系统源码
排课系统
源码授权
排课系统报价
排课系统
产品报价

随着教育信息化的不断推进,传统的固定班级管理模式逐渐被灵活的“走班制”所取代。特别是在上海这样的大城市,教育资源丰富,学生人数众多,如何高效地进行课程安排成为教育管理的重要课题。为此,走班排课系统应运而生,它不仅提升了教学资源的利用率,还为学生提供了更加个性化的学习路径。

走班排课系统的核心目标是通过计算机技术,实现课程、教师、教室和学生的智能匹配,避免冲突,提高排课效率。这一过程涉及大量的算法计算和数据处理,因此,系统的性能和稳定性至关重要。尤其是在上海这样的超大城市,面对复杂的教学环境和庞大的数据量,传统排课方式已难以满足需求,必须依靠先进的信息技术手段。

近年来,云计算技术的快速发展为走班排课系统提供了强大的技术支持。云计算能够提供弹性计算资源、分布式存储以及高效的网络通信能力,使得系统可以轻松应对高并发访问和大规模数据处理的需求。同时,借助云平台的自动化运维能力,系统维护成本也大幅降低。

排课系统

在实际应用中,走班排课系统通常采用微服务架构进行开发。这种架构将系统拆分为多个独立的服务模块,如课程管理、教师调度、教室分配等,每个模块都可以独立部署和扩展。这种方式不仅提高了系统的灵活性,也便于后期功能迭代和故障排查。

走班排课系统

此外,人工智能技术的引入进一步提升了走班排课系统的智能化水平。通过机器学习算法,系统可以自动分析历史排课数据,预测可能出现的冲突,并给出最优解决方案。例如,基于规则的排课算法虽然简单有效,但在面对复杂场景时往往显得力不从心;而结合深度学习的模型则能够更好地理解多维约束条件,生成更合理的排课方案。

为了确保系统的高效运行,数据处理是关键环节之一。走班排课系统需要处理大量结构化和非结构化数据,包括学生选课信息、教师授课时间、教室使用情况等。为此,系统通常采用分布式数据库技术,如Hadoop或Spark,以提高数据读取和写入的速度。同时,数据清洗和预处理也是不可忽视的部分,只有经过合理处理的数据才能为后续的排课逻辑提供可靠支持。

在上海的实践中,走班排课系统还面临着一些特殊挑战。例如,不同学校之间可能存在差异化的排课规则和管理制度,这就要求系统具备高度的可配置性和兼容性。为此,系统设计通常采用插件化架构,允许用户根据自身需求定制排课逻辑和界面展示方式。

另外,安全性也是走班排课系统不可忽视的问题。由于系统涉及大量的个人信息和教学数据,必须采取严格的安全措施,如数据加密、访问控制和审计日志等,以防止数据泄露或非法访问。特别是在上海这样的信息化程度较高的地区,网络安全事件频发,系统必须具备完善的防护机制。

在用户体验方面,走班排课系统也需要不断优化。一个良好的用户界面不仅可以提高操作效率,还能增强用户的满意度。因此,系统开发过程中应充分考虑人机交互设计,如提供可视化排课界面、实时反馈机制以及移动端适配功能,使教师和学生能够随时随地进行课程查询和调整。

未来,随着5G、物联网和边缘计算等新技术的发展,走班排课系统有望实现更深层次的智能化和自动化。例如,通过物联网设备实时采集教室使用状态,系统可以动态调整排课方案;而边缘计算则能够在本地完成部分计算任务,减少对云端的依赖,提升响应速度。

总之,走班排课系统作为现代教育管理的重要工具,其技术实现离不开云计算、人工智能和大数据等前沿技术的支持。在上海这样的城市,系统的成功应用不仅提升了教育管理的效率,也为其他地区提供了可借鉴的经验。未来,随着技术的不断进步,走班排课系统将在更多领域发挥更大的作用。

本站部分内容及素材来源于互联网,如有侵权,联系必删!

首页
关于我们
在线试用
电话咨询